CLARIFICATION OF COMMENTS MADE DURING THE JUNE 21, 1988 BRIEFING BY TVA ON THE TVA REORGANIZATION AND PLANT STATUS During the subject briefing, in my response to a question asked by Chairman Zech on Browns Ferry Nuclear Plant (BFN) fire protection requirements, I may have given the impression that TVA intended to fully comply with the National Fire Protection Association (NFPA) Code in the long term.

I want to clarify this statement to avoid any misinterpretation by NRC.

TVA intends to bring 8FN into compliance with the NFPA code with deviations as approved by NRC.

As I stated in my testimony, this is a long-term goal and is not to be accomplished entirely before startup. Our letter on the deviations with justifications was submitted to NRC on August 3, 1988.

Except as modified in our August 3 letter, the upgrade schedule and project descriptions l

were submitted to NRC in section III of the fire protection report supplement submitted on April 4, 1988.
